Q 8 - Ram, Mohan and Pawan invest Rs 1000, Rs 4000 and Rs 5000 respectively in a business. At the end of the year the balance sheet shows a loss of 20% of the total initial investment. Find the share of loss of each partner.
Answer : C
Explanation
Total initial investment = Rs (1000 + 4000 + 5000) = Rs 10000 Total loss = 20% of total investment = 20/100 * 10000 = Rs 2000 Ratio of investment by all partners = 1000 : 4000 : 5000 = 1 : 4 : 5 Sum of the ratios = 1 + 4 +5 = 10 Share of loss for Ram = 1/10 * 2000 = Rs 200 Share of loss for Mohan = 4/10 * 2000 = Rs 800 Share of loss for Pawan = 5/10 * 2000 = Rs 1000
Q 9 - Kabir starts a business with Re 4,50,000/- Nisha joins him after a certain period of time who invests Re 3,00,000/-. At the end of year, they divide profir in the ratio 9:4. When did Nisha join Kabir?
Answer : D
Explanation
Suppose Nisha is with Kabir for x months. So, 4,50,000*12/3,00,000*x = 9/4 Or, x = 8 months Hence Nisha joined Kabir after (12 - 8) months = 4 months.
Q 10 - Amit and Binod enter into partnership business with Re 5000 and Re 4000 respectively. After 1/4th of the time Amit contributes additional Re 2000. One month after the start of the business, Binod withdraws 1/4th his capital. Jagan then joins the business with a capital investment of Re 7000. The profit at the year-end is Re 2304. Find the share of profit for each investors.
Answer : A
Explanation
Bringing down the investment to 1 month, Amit's investment = (5000*12) + (2000*9) = Re 78000 Binod's investment = (4000*1) + (3000*11) = Re 37000 Jagan's investment = (7000*11) = Re 77000 Amit : Binod : Jagan = 78 : 37 : 77 Sum of ratios = 78+37+77 = 192 Amit's share = 78/192 * 2304 = Re 936 Binod's share = 37/192 * 2304 = Re 444 Jagan's share = 77/192 * 2304 = Re 924
